Treachery refers to harmful acts you might do to someone who trusts you. A treacherous road might be icy or otherwise likely to cause a car accident. If you tell everyone in school your best friend's carefully guarded secret, you've behaved treacherously. A little boy might treacherously give away his sister's hiding place during a game of hide and seek and his sister, in turn, might treacherously announce to some older kids that he's scared of the dark.
